Clean Power Plan Will Help Us Win “The Race of Our Lives” – EDF President Fred Krupp
August 2, 2015
“In a video released last night, the Obama Administration announced that it will finalize the Clean Power Plan on Monday. ‘Climate change is not a problem for another generation — not anymore,’ the President declared.
“We could not agree more. With this historic announcement, the United States is making clear that it is no longer acceptable to put unlimited amounts of climate pollution into our air. The move toward a world safe from climate change is beginning in earnest.
“This is the race of our lives. Climate change is the biggest threat facing us right now. It’s a clear and present danger to every human being on the planet. It threatens to undermine every aspect of American society if we don’t address it.
“The Clean Power Plan will reduce carbon emissions from power plant smokestacks – and by doing so it also creates new opportunities to continue development of the strong, vibrant clean energy economy that is creating prosperity. The states that join the race first, and run it the fastest, will win both more investment in clean technologies and less air pollution for their communities. And we will all benefit from less severe temperature increases, less dangerous sea level rise, and fewer ferocious storms.
“No single step will fix climate change, but the Clean Power Plan is also a catalyst for more and quicker pollution reductions in the future, as we continue to innovate and grow the economy.
“The President is using his authority under the Clean Air Act because it is his responsibility to carry out the law and protect our nation’s climate security, and because Congress has failed to adopt comprehensive climate solutions. Eventually Congress must pass a comprehensive, market-based system that puts a price on climate pollution from major emitters and gives business an incentive to develop new clean energy solutions.
“The President is demonstrating leadership and we are prepared to work to ensure the promise of the Clean Power Plan becomes a reality.”
- Fred Krupp, president of Environmental Defense Fund
